"This semi-detached house with three double bedrooms is deceptively spacious and therefore must be viewed to appreciate the accommodation on offer. This comprises; hall, utility room, lounge, open plan dining room and kitchen, three bedrooms and family bathroom. Externally there are gardens to front and rear and a garage with light and power. The property is double glazed and centrally heated and very well presented throughout.

ENTRANCE HALL    Understairs storage cupboard, radiator, wood effect laminate flooring and double glazed window to the side and door to the front.

LOUNGE 14'2" x 9'1" (4.32m x 2.77m). Radiator, double glazed window to the front, wood effect laminate flooring, open plan through to:

DINING ROOM 16'7" x 10'7" (5.05m x 3.23m). Double glazed window to the rear, wood effect laminate flooring, two radiators.

KITCHEN 13'8" x 6'7" (4.17m x 2m). Range of wall and base units with roll top laminated work surface over, stainless steel sink drainer unit, integrated oven and hob with stainless steel extractor hood over, space for fridge/freezer, double glazed window and door to the rear.

UTILITY ROOM    Plumbing for washing machine, wall mounted central heating boiler, frosted double glazed window to the front.

LANDING    Storage cupboard, loft access, double glazed window to the side.

BEDROOM ONE 14'2" x 9'2" (4.32m x 2.8m). Double glazed window to the front, feature fireplace and radiator.

BEDROOM TWO 16'7" x 8'8" (5.05m x 2.64m). Double glazed window to the rear and radiator.

BEDROOM THREE 13'5" x 8'9" (4.1m x 2.67m). Double glazed window to the rear and radiator.

BATHROOM 11'10" x 8'4" (3.6m x 2.54m). Low level wc, pedestal wash hand basin, panelled bath and window to the front.

OUTSIDE    The front garden is laid to lawn with a paved pathway. To the rear the garden is laid to lawn with side access and detached garage.

DETACHED GARAGE 21'10" x 14' (6.65m x 4.27m). With up and over door to the front, window to the side, light and power.
